410 providers in Anesthesiology, Cardiac Electrophysiology, Critical Care Medicine, Infectious Diseases, Nephrology (kidney)

410 providers in Anesthesiology, Cardiac Electrophysiology, Critical Care Medicine, Infectious Diseases, Nephrology (kidney)